What will I learn?
Gain hands-on skills in selecting, biasing, and verifying FETs for dependable production circuits. Master device physics, datasheet analysis, DC bias calculations, small-signal gain, and ADC interfacing. Tackle variations, ensure thermal reliability, optimise layouts, and apply testing for circuits resilient to supply, temperature, and component changes.

Develop skills
- Master FET datasheets: pull Vth, gm, Idss, and SOA for solid designs.
- Design DC bias: calculate Id, Vgs, Vds for JFETs and MOSFETs using quick, reliable methods.
- Model small-signals: determine gain, impedance, and bandwidth in practical circuits.
- Design ADC front-ends: bias, buffer, and drive SAR ADCs with FET stages.
- Create variation-resistant layouts: counter Vth, temperature, and supply changes in FET amplifiers.
